Maple Ridge: What Makes Our Town Special

Maple Ridge, oh Maple Ridge! What isn't special about our little slice of paradise? Nestled between the Fraser River and the Golden Ears mountains, we've got natural beauty in spades. But it's more than just pretty scenery; it's the people, the community spirit, and the unique character that makes Maple Ridge truly shine.

We're a town with a rich history, from our roots in forestry and agriculture to our present-day blend of urban and rural lifestyles. We're a community that values its heritage while embracing the future. You see it in our local businesses, our community events, and the friendly faces you meet walking down the street. This unique blend creates a vibrant and welcoming atmosphere that's hard to find anywhere else.

Key Issues Facing Maple Ridge Today

Alright, let's get real for a second. No town is perfect, and Maple Ridge is no exception. We've got our fair share of challenges to tackle, and it's important to be aware of them so we can work together to find solutions. So, what are some of the key issues facing Maple Ridge today?

Affordable Housing is a big one. Like many communities in the Lower Mainland, Maple Ridge is struggling with a lack of affordable housing options. This makes it difficult for young people, families, and seniors to find suitable places to live. Skyrocketing prices and limited availability put a strain on many residents, and it's a problem that needs urgent attention. We need to explore a variety of solutions, including increasing the supply of affordable housing units, implementing policies that protect tenants, and providing financial assistance to those who need it most.

Traffic and Transportation are also major concerns. As our population grows, our roads are becoming more congested, and our public transportation system is struggling to keep up. This leads to longer commute times, increased air pollution, and frustration for residents. We need to invest in transportation infrastructure, including roads, bridges, and public transit. We also need to encourage alternative modes of transportation, such as cycling and walking. By improving our transportation system, we can reduce traffic congestion, improve air quality, and make it easier for people to get around.
